What companies run services between La Plata, Argentina and Villa Adelina, Argentina?

You can take a train from La Plata to Villa Adelina via Constitución, Constitucion, Retiro, and Estación Retiro Belgrano in around 2h 18m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Calle 41_Calle 3 to Paraná 5999 via Bartolo me mitre y ecuador and 2848 Mitre Bartolome in around 2h 39m.
